Panama leads with ban on plastic bags

Tuesday, July 23, 2019


Panama became the first Central American nation to ban single-use plastic bags to try to curb pollution on its beaches and help tackle what the United Nations has identified as one of the world’s biggest environmental challenges.

The isthmus nation joined more than 60 other countries that have totally or partially banned single-use plastic bags, including Chile and Colombia, Reuters reports.
